Only a win will satisfy the home supporters in this Caledonian Stadium clash with Arbroath, having a healthy lead on the opposition in the Championship table.

Both teams should be fairly well rested for this game, as they have had some quiet days to prepare. Hopefully this will translate into lots of action on the pitch.

Inverness CT form and stats

Inverness CT, who have the most clean sheets (10) in Championship, are steadily winning Championship games and points here at Caledonian Stadium. 6 wins, 1 draw and 2 defeats is the summary from 9 games. It’s been three wins in a row for Inverness CT here at Caledonian Stadium, hoping to make this one the fourth consecutive victory.

Inverness CT's previous game was a Championship match also played at home, ending 2-0 versus Dunfermline Athletic (placed 5th). The home side are looking to build on that result. Prior to that was the away defeat visiting Partick Thistle (1-3).

The Inverness CT fans have had their share of opportunities to cheer home goals this season, having seen 17 goals in 9 league matches. 9 goals have been conceded.

Arbroath form and stats

There's been little loot from Arbroath's travels as they have only collected 7 points from 9 away games in the Championship. Arbroath only have 2 wins to counter their 6 defeats and 1 draw.

Arbroath aren't clicking offensively as they have gone 222 league minutes without a goal. M. McKenna was the last player to find the net.

It might be tough going out on the road again for Arbroath, facing their second straight away game. Especially as the previous game, ended with a defeat 0-2 versus Queen of the South (placed 6th). The game before that, was lost at home, a 0-1 defeat against Dundee United.

The visitors have scored 7 goals from 9 away games in the league, an average of less than one per game. Arbroath have conceded 13 goals in these away matches.

Head 2 Head

The most recent history between these sides is the Arbroath - Inverness CT 3-0 played earlier this season. Inverness CT-Arbroath H2H statistics last five meetings regardless of arena: Inverness CT 3 wins, Arbroath 1 win, 1 draw. 4 of these five matches had three or more goals (over 2,5).

The Scottish Championship is the second level of the Scottish Professional Football League. Ten teams play each other four times for a total of 36 fixtures in a season from August to May. The winner in the league table promotes to the Premiership and a playoff can promote one more team.
